// CANARY_GATE_THRESHOLDS controls how the Larkspur deploy pipeline
// decides whether a canary proceeds to full rollout. Support should
// know: the canary must hold error rates below 0.5% and p95 latency
// under 300ms for two consecutive evaluation windows before Larkspur
// promotes it. If either check fails, rollback is automatic and a
// notice is posted to the on-call channel. Do not advise customers
// to retry until the gate clears. When escalating a stuck canary,
// always attach the token shown below.

build token for bafog-tajof: htk31_1b24c4729098a6a52602a7306814351

Ticket #—: Prefetch config vault locked out

While reviewing the Cartograph prefetcher PR, I tried to pull the staging tile-quota config and found the vault locked after three failed attempts by CI. The review is blocked: I can't verify the prefetch budget changes against the real limits. No data loss, just access. Per policy, any reviewer can unseal it manually rather than waiting for the rotation window. Use the recovery passphrase below to unseal the vault.

vault phrase of bagaf-kajeg = jorath-feniel-briir-siliel-ralix

## Formula sandbox tuning

User-supplied formulas in Gridmoor execute inside a restricted interpreter with hard ceilings on time, memory, and call depth. Reviewers should confirm any change to these ceilings is justified in the PR description, since raising them widens the abuse surface. Defaults were chosen from production traces. The current limits are as follows.

limits module of tafog-fawip:
WEIGHTS = {
    "julix": 57,
    "lamys": 992,
    "kasvan": 209,
    "quenok": 750,
    "alddor": 259,
    "oliath": 1009,
    "wenix": 815,
}